Kanpaikti
Town
Photo: Ericwinny,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Kan Paik Ti is a town in Waingmaw Township, Myitkyina District, Kachin State of Myanmar. The town is home to one of 5 official border trade posts with China, and opened on 23 August 1998. Kanpaikti is situated 4 km southwest of Warawng Pum.
